Organisms need to obtain energy via cellular respiration because it is the process by which they convert the energy stored in food molecules into a usable form known as ATP (adenosine triphosphate). ATP is the "energy currency" of the cell and is required for various cellular activities, including growth, reproduction, movement, and maintaining basic cellular functions.
